CCC1.0.0: 3 Configuration - Digizuite Adobe Creative Cloud Connector
After finishing the installation, you may configure the Digizuite™ Adobe Creative Cloud Connector under the Config parameters in the ConfigManager.
3.1 Config parameters
Navigate to System Tools → Config → Digizuite™ Adobe Creative Cloud Connector and select the correct version. Select the Config parameters tab where the following parameters apply:
- Portal menu (required field: Media Manager Menu (50188) ) - Specifies the metadata tree used for the site menu.
- Sorting types (required field: This field is pre populated with Date & Alphabetic) - Specifies which sorting capabilities the site offers.
- Default sorting (required field: This field is prepopulated with Date) - Sets the default sorting.
- Main search folder (required field: This field is prepopulated with Digizuite™ Adobe Creative Cloud Connector) - References the root channel folder for search engines. Typically, this would not include profile images and the likes.
- Low resolution media formats (required field: This field is prepopulated with JPG small) - A list of low resolution media formats that should be used in the Creative Cloud extension
- High resolution media formats (required field: This field is prepopulated with JPG Big Preview) -A list of high resolution media formats that should be used in the Creative Cloud extension
- Media url (required field: This field is prepopulated with DAM centre URL) - URL to asset streamer (remember to delete ":443" if it's present and add / (slash) in the end of the URL if it's not present)
3.2 Searches
The Connector searches metadata in the language configured for the logged-in user. If the connector user is set to have default language: English, only metadata in the English language sections are searched. Metadata set in the other languages will not be searched.
Searches are defined in the Config manager of the product → searches → DigiZuite_System_Framework_Search.
You might have to populate the searches manually. If you see a cogwheel similar to the one shown below, then you need to press it. This will populate the search for you:
By default, the freetext search will search in the fields: assetName, assetDescription, assetKeywords
